There are six established routes to hike Mount Kilimanjaro Marangu, Machame, Lemosho, Shira, Rongai and Umbwe. For those who only have six days to hike Kilimanjaro, the Machame route is the best choice because of its acclimatization profile. Compared to other six day routes, this route exposes the hiker to higher elevations quicker which kickstarts the bodyรขโ‚ฌโ„ขs adaptation to altitude. Day 1 - Begin from Machame Gate (1800m) trek to Machame Camp (3000m).
Today is the start of your exhilarating journey to the Roof of Africa! After a hearty breakfast, you'll head to Machame Gate (1800m/5905ft), the entrance to Kilimanjaro National Park. Here, you'll complete the necessary registration and paperwork before embarking on your trek. The trail takes you through lush rainforests, filled with a variety of flora and fauna. As you ascend through the captivating scenery, you may encounter some of the unique wildlife that inhabits the area, including various bird species and the elusive Colobus monkeys. After an invigorating hike, you'll reach Machame Camp (3000m/9842ft), where you'll spend the night amidst the tranquility of the mountains.

Day 2 - Star from Machame Camp (3000m) to Shira Camp (3840m).
With the sun rising over the mountains, you'll enjoy a delicious breakfast before commencing your trek to Shira Camp. Today's trek takes you through the moorland zone, characterized by its heather and volcanic rocks. The ever-changing landscapes and the grandeur of Kilimanjaro will keep you motivated as you ascend to an elevation of 3840m (12,598ft). Throughout the day's journey, you'll be treated to spectacular panoramic views of the surrounding landscapes. As you approach Shira Camp, the sight of the campsite amidst the high-altitude desert will take your breath away. After a rewarding hike of approximately 5km/3 miles, you'll settle in for the night, filled with excitement for the adventures that lie ahead.

Day 3 - Proceed trek to Shira Cave (3840m) up to Barranco Camp (3900m).
Leaving the picturesque Shira Camp behind, you'll traverse the rocky terrains and continue your ascent towards Barranco Camp. The highlight of today's trek is conquering the Great Barranco Wall, a challenging yet exhilarating climb that rewards you with awe-inspiring views of the mountain. As you reach an altitude of 3900m (12,795ft), the landscape transforms, and you'll find yourself surrounded by giant Senecio and Lobelia plants. Barranco Camp, nestled in a valley, offers a unique and memorable camping experience.

Day 4 - Continue trekking from Barranco Camp (3900m) to Barafu Camp (4600m).
Today's journey takes you through diverse terrains, and the trek leads you to Karanga Valley. From there, you'll connect to the Mweka route, making your way to Barafu Camp at an altitude of 4600m (15,091ft). The trail offers a mix of challenges and rewards, and with each step, you'll feel the anticipation building as you prepare for the final ascent to the summit. The majestic glaciers of Kilimanjaro will come into view, reminding you of the grandeur of this natural wonder. At Barafu Camp, you'll rest and recharge for the summit attempt that awaits you.

Day 5 - Trek from Barafu Camp (4,680 m) summit to Uhuru Peak (5,895m) Down to Mweka Camp (3,100m).
Today is the day you've been waiting for รขโ‚ฌโ€œ the summit attempt! You'll begin your ascent during the night to take advantage of the cooler temperatures and witness the breathtaking sunrise from the summit. The trek to Stella Point (5735m/18815ft) will test your determination and endurance, but the sight of the sun painting the sky in hues of orange and pink will energize your spirit. From Stella Point, you'll continue to Uhuru Peak (5895m/19,340ft), the highest point in Africa, where you'll stand on the "Roof of Africa" and savor an overwhelming sense of achievement. Spend some cherished moments at the summit, taking photographs and cherishing the memories of this remarkable accomplishment. As you begin your descent, the landscapes change once again, and you'll return to Barafu Camp for a well-deserved rest. From there, you'll continue to Mweka Camp, located at an altitude of 3100m (10170ft), where you'll spend the night.

Day 6 - Trek to Mweka Camp (3,100m) fishin up to Mweka Gate (1,650m).
On the final day of your trek, you'll wake up to a sense of accomplishment, knowing that you have conquered Kilimanjaro's peak. After a hearty breakfast, you'll celebrate with your guides and porters, who have been instrumental in making your journey a success. The descent will take you through the lush and dense upper forest, offering a pleasant and refreshing hiking experience. As you continue your descent, you'll reach Mweka Gate (1650m/5413ft), where you'll receive your well-earned summit certificates. This achievement will be a cherished souvenir of your incredible adventure on Africa's highest mountain.
